The illness we have come to know as AIDS was first identified in 1981. The cause of the illness, the HIV virus, was identified in 1983.
The first virus to be isolated and identified was the tobacco mosaic virus in 1892 by Russian scientist Dmitri Ivanovsky.
The hantavirus is named after the Hantan River in South Korea, which was where the virus was first identified during the Korean War in the 1950s.

Coxsackie virus was discovered by Gilbert Dalldorf. He named the virus after the town of Coxsackie, New York, where he discovered the virus while doing research on polio.
